WebGatsby and Nick both come from the West, a place where people express compassion, ambition, strength, love, and order. Nick immediately connects with Gatsby through similar backgrounds and the way Gatsby seems more welcoming than the other party-goers. When they first meet, Nick explains how Gatsby smiles at him.
